Operational Best Practices

Follow these operational best practices to reduce recurring Payables Agent issues.

Area Best practice
Invoice submission Use corporate email aliases and maintain forwarding rules to the Payables Agent endpoint.
Supplier communication Provide suppliers with clear file-format, attachment, and invoice-submission standards.
Supplier master data Keep supplier names, addresses, sites, and tax-registration information aligned with invoice content.
Purchase orders Use consistent and distinctive purchase order numbering formats where possible.
Business Unit derivation Select one derivation strategy and validate it with representative invoices before rollout.
Training Focus training on high-volume suppliers, recurring layouts, and suppliers with high exception volume.
Adaptive learning Ensure users save corrections consistently so learning can be reused.
Bulk learning and reprocessing Review affected invoices to confirm that corrections were applied only where appropriate.
Invoice Completion Use one target attribute per policy and test policies with matching and nonmatching invoices.
Anomaly controls Begin with selected controls, tune their criteria, and review false positives regularly.
Reporting Review recognition reports regularly to identify recurring supplier, attribute, and layout issues.
Security Validate both page access and Business Unit data access using actual user accounts.
Scanning Standardize scanner settings before expanding rollout to additional teams or suppliers.
